| Abstract: |
This entry represents uroporphyrinogen decarboxylase (HemE), which catalyzes the fifth step in the heme biosynthetic pathway, converting uroporphyrinogen III to coproporphyrinogen III by decarboxylating the four acetate side chains of the substrate [PMID:9564029]. This step takes the pathway toward protoporphyrin IX, a common precursor of both heme and chlorophyll, rather than toward precorrin 2 and its products. This activity is essential in all organisms, and subnormal activity of URO-D leads to the most common form of porphyria in humans, porphyria cutanea tarda (PCT). |
